Job Responsibilities

  • Assemble electronic components using assembly drawings, diagrams, and job aids to meet customer requirements.
  • The candidate may perform processes including but not limited to: fine-pitch soldering of circuit card assemblies, BGA rework and repair of circuit cards, manual and automated assembly of microelectronics, electromechanical assembly, semi-rigid wire and cable harness fabrication and installation, winding and encapsulation of transformers, depending on business need and workload capacity.
  • Perform all assembly work in accordance with industry and company standards.
  • Perform continuity checks on in process and completed work.
  • Operate basic production equipment (e.g., soldering stations, crimp tools, microscopes, ovens) in a safe and controlled manner.
  • Inspect work for workmanship and compliance to released build documentation; identify and help resolve nonconformances, including performing rework and repair.
  • Record production data accurately in travelers, shop floor systems, and quality records.
  • Collaborate with technicians, engineers, and supervisors to clarify build instructions and suggest improvements to processes and tooling.
  • Follow all safety, ESD, FOD, and cleanliness guidelines to maintain a safe and compliant work area.
  • Successfully complete in-house workmanship criteria training classes for continued employment.
